Title: To amend the Management Compensation Plan, Ordinance 2713-2013, as amended, by increasing pay rates which are below the new State of Ohio minimum wage; to modify language regarding Personal Leave of Absence; to recognize Civil Service Commission action; and to declare an emergency.
Attachments: 1. Ord 2935-2019 Amending Ord 2713-2013 Sections 5 & 11 - 120919.pdf

Explanation

 

This ordinance amends the Management Compensation Plan, Ordinance 2713-2013, as amended, by increasing pay rates which are below the new State of Ohio minimum wage, effective January 1, 2020; to modify and clarify language in several sections; and to recognize Civil Service Commission action to revise and abolish various classifications.

 

Emergency action is recommended in order to begin implementation.

WHEREAS, it is necessary to amend the Management Compensation Plan by amending certain classifications in Sections 5(D) and 5(F) to recognize the new State of Ohio minimum wage, effective January 1, 2020; and

 

WHEREAS, it is necessary to amend the Management Compensation Plan by amending a classification in Section 5(E) to recognize Civil Service Commission action; and

 

WHEREAS, it is necessary to amend the Management Compensation Plan by amending Section 11(A), modifying language regarding Personal Leave of Absence; and

 

WHEREAS, an emergency exists in the usual daily operation of the City in that it is immediately necessary to amend certain provisions of the Management Compensation Plan, thereby preserving the public peace, property, health, safety, and welfare; Now, Therefore

 

B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F COLUMBUS:
